Glory

/ˈɡlɔːri/
High praise, honor, or distinction given for an achievement or due to a notable quality.

Etymology:

etymology
The word glory comes from the Old French glorie (fame, praise) and Latin gloria (fame, renown, great praise or honor), dating back to the 14th century.
